Output 07f3ba99112651d5c19ca78622b66d0e3f2af27b3cf34d25846169fb4af54322:0

value
19700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2404938a491e8576c94f4de71525f2257c5eb836 OP_EQUALVERIFY OP_CHECKSIG
address
14HSosjpC5g8fUxrV38igWUqKR2fuDovx7
transaction
07f3ba99112651d5c19ca78622b66d0e3f2af27b3cf34d25846169fb4af54322
spent
true